10 Items to Consider
Purpose of Use: Will the teacher be collecting responses that are critical to the success of the
student, such as attendance or participation points? What type of
assessments: formative, summative, benchmarking, etc.?
Policies: Due to the nature of Insight 360 Cloud as a mobile device tool, it may be
necessary to review acceptable use policies if a BYOD policy will be
implemented simultaneously.
Implementation Plan: Ensuring that all those impacted by a new mobile initiative such as IT staff,
trainers, teachers, etc. will help prepare for an easy implementation.
eInstruction by Turning Technologies can assist with implementation efforts
and plans.
Power Management: Students may arrive at class to discover low battery power, in which devices
will automatically shut off during class and unable to respond to Insight 360
Cloud questions. Having clickers readily available so that students can easily
respond with clickers when power is low is recommended.
IT Staff: IT departments are tasked with managing large and complex infrastructures,
often utilizing limited resources. However, the involvement of the IT
department in planning, implementing and supporting Insight 360 Cloud is
important. Discussing the availability of IT assistance is advised.
Students: Most Insight 360 Cloud implementations involve use of personal student
devices. According to recent students, a majority of K-12 students have
access to web-enabled devices, including the following:
Students with Access to Tablets:
ď‚· 41% of Grades K-2
ď‚· 58% of Grades 3-5
2. ď‚· 61% of Grades 6-8
ď‚· 50% of Grades 9-12
Students with Access to Laptops:
ď‚· 41% of Grades K-2
ď‚· 62% of Grades 3-5
ď‚· 66% of Grades 6-8
ď‚· 66% of Grades 9-12
It is important to have accommodations for those that do not. Additionally,
alerting students to the use of a cellular connection for responding may
impact data plan charges. For Insight 360 Cloud Mobile Edition, Student App
and Web Access requirements must also be taken into consideration.

Bandwidth: Consultation with a Technical Sales Engineer is recommended to ensure that
bandwidth is adequate to facilitate Insight 360 Cloud sessions. Various factors
affect the overall capacity of the connection including number of users,
question types asked and current infrastructure systems. Recommendations
for bandwidth to support common Insight 360 Cloud uses within classrooms
and buildings can be made pre-sale.
Access Points: Enterprise class (managed) wireless networks with controllers are
recommended to support Insight 360 Cloud. Adding access points requires
expertise in order to determine whether you have implemented for coverage
or capacity.
Data Limits: Access points should be centrally managed using solutions that can control
data limits as well as data types. Understanding if there are data limit
restrictions either by volume (per person usage) or data type before you start
an Insight 360 Cloud session.
